Cecelia Harvey was born in 1819 in Bing Creek, Harrison County, (now West Virginia), Virginia, USA, the child of Jonathan Harvey And Sarah Harbert. Cecelia Harvey married Joseph B Taylor, and had children including Sarah Jane Taylor. Cecelia Harvey passed away in 1905 in Pleasant Grove, Utah, Utah, USA.
